The Seaside Within Me
by Jeannie E. Roberts

“In the end, I want my heart to be covered in stretch marks.”
–Andrea Gibson, American Poet and Activist (August 13, 1975 – July 14, 2025)

After many a summer
in the green unending of my garden
where the serenade of bees hummed
with the keepers of color
phlox
iris
and lilies held my hand
as I stepped inside the drum of my essence
experienced the blooms and wounds
the pinks
purples
and lavenders of my life.
Here
in the orbit of being
summer became fall.
The maple trees had lost their leaves
though the seaside within me
revealed an ongoing glow
where aqua skies
echoed oceanic views.
On the beach of my soul
etched with both delight and despair
my heart was covered in stretch marks.
